Frequently Asked Questions about Cramer Hill
How much are Studio apartments in Cramer Hill?
There are currently 99 Studio Apartments in Cramer Hill with rent ranges from $995 to $3,682 with an average price of $1,775.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cramer Hill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cramer Hill ranges from $995 to $3,608 with an average monthly rent of $2,087.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cramer Hill c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cramer Hill range from $1,195 to $10,070.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,853.
How expensive are Cramer Hill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 58 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Cramer Hill on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,295 to $8,400 - averaging $4,223 for the location.
